Number of forced migrants in Tyumen Oblast in 2020: 7 people.

Change versus 2019: −13 people (indicator fell by 65%).

Place among Russian regions

In 2020, Tyumen Oblast holds position 21 in the list by magnitude out of 56 (full regional ranking).

Comparison with the Russian average

The Russian average in 2020 was 2,512 people. The region's value is below the national average.
